介绍MSSQL数据库
Microsoft SQL Server,简称MSSQL或SQL Server,是一款由Microsoft开发的关系数据库管理系统(RDBMS)。它包括一个可扩展的关系数据库引擎和一组数据管理工具,适用于存储、分析和保护数据。作为市场上最受欢迎的关系数据库之一,MSSQL在企业中具有广泛的应用,为企业带来了更多的可能性。
1. MSSQL的使用场景
MSSQL是一款流行的商业数据库,适用于各种应用场景,包括:
企业内部应用程序:MSSQL可以用于存储企业内部应用程序的数据。企业可以使用MSSQL的安全性和稳定性来保护自己的数据。
网站后端:MSSQL可以用于存储网站后端数据。它可以将数据与其他Microsoft应用程序进行无缝集成,如Azure和SharePoint。
商业智能:MSSQL可以用于存储和分析大量的数据。它包括强大的内置分析功能和数据挖掘工具,可以为业务提供价值。
2. MSSQL数据管理
MSSQL具有一组数据管理工具,可以帮助企业管理其数据。MSSQL的数据管理工具包括:
SQL Server Management Studio(SSMS):SSMS是MSSQL的集成开发环境(IDE),用于管理和开发MSSQL数据库。使用SSMS,企业可以执行各种任务,如管理安全性、创建数据库、备份和还原数据库等。
SQL Server Data Tools(SSDT):SSDT是一套程序开发工具,用于在MSSQL上创建和管理数据库。SSDT包括各种功能,如T-SQL编辑器、查询生成器和数据比较工具。
3. MSSQL的安全性
对于企业来说,保护其数据是至关重要的。MSSQL提供了多种安全功能,以保护企业数据的完整性和机密性。MSSQL的安全功能包括:
数据加密:MSSQL使用透明数据加密(TDE)功能来加密数据。TDE自动加密数据文件,可以在磁盘上保护数据。
访问控制:MSSQL使用基于角色的安全模型,授权用户访问数据库的特定部分。管理员可以控制谁能够访问数据库的哪些部分。
4. MSSQL在云端的应用
随着云计算的普及,越来越多的企业将其数据和应用程序移至云端。MSSQL在云端上也具有广泛的应用。MSSQL在云端上的应用包括:
Azure SQL数据库:这是在Microsoft Azure云平台上托管的关系数据库服务。它提供了与本地MSSQL数据库一样的功能,同时提供了可扩展性、安全性和高可用性。
云中的SQL Server VM:这是在云端上运行MSSQL的虚拟机。企业可以在Microsoft Azure中为其应用程序创建自己的MSSQL服务器,同时能够利用公有云的优势。
结论
MSSQL是一款功能强大的关系数据库,具有广泛的应用。对于企业来说,MSSQL可以带来更多的可能性,如数据管理、商业智能和云端应用。此外,MSSQL在安全性方面提供了多种功能,可以保护企业的数据。通过使用MSSQL,企业可以更轻松地管理其数据和应用程序,获得更大的商业价值。
SELECT * FROM customers;